There are a number of ways to get fit and lose weight- cardio exercises, dieting, resistance training, sports, or any combination of these. It’s just a matter of finding the right combo of exercises that fits a person’s schedule, physical capacity and preferences.

For fat loss, it’s a proven fact that any exercise combined with cardio sessions brings relatively faster results. Still, plenty of people get bored with conventional routines and find it a challenge to keep working-out consistently. The key to speedy fat loss is constant exercise, so going about it in a half-hearted manner will not yield significant results and cause further loss of motivation.

A lot of people are still unaware of the usefulness of Pilates for losing weight and getting lean. More than a few novice gym goers stop working-out because they find their programs too dull and tiring. Because Pilates workouts are done at a low intensity and are invigorating, they’re actually perfect for beginners who want to lose belly fat without dreading each session.

Pilates exercises can also be light enough to be able to help elderly fitness buffs and those with minor injuries stay in shape. After just a few sessions, one will notice a significant improvement in the body’s flexibility, posture and mental alertness.

Cardio combined with strength training is the most common exercise program prescribed for fast and effective fat loss. Incorporating Pilates sessions with these will improve fat-burning efficiency of your workouts even more.

Along with cardio exercise, resistance training through free weights or machines is needed in a good fat-loss exercise program because the extra muscle tissues help fight flab. Muscle development can lead to stiffness of however and this is where the stretches and joint-loosening moves in Pilates can come in handy.

Core-based exercises are the essentially what Pilates is about. Simultaneous effort of the muscles of the abdomen, the waist, lumbar region and buttocks allow faster calorie burn- leading to faster loss of weight due to a reduced body fat index.

Maintaining proper metabolism means conditioning the body to maximize expenditure of caloric energy. Toning-up muscle tissue through consistent limbering movements significantly raises the level of metabolism, making it easier to lose calories from body fat.
